Manchester City captain Vincent Kompany returns for Tottenham Hotspur clash

Vincent Kompany returns for Spurs clash

Manchester City manager Manuel Pellegrini has confirmed that captain Vincent Kompany will return to the squad for this weekend's Premier League clash against Tottenham Hotspur.

The Belgium international missed last weekend's 2-1 defeat to West Ham United with a calf injury.

Now though, the former English champions have been boosted by the return of their skipper, but David Silva will play no part in Saturday's encounter at White Hart Lane.

"It's important for the team to have Vincent back," Pellegrini told reporters in today's press conference. "He's just recovering, he's the captain and he played well at the start of the season. Not just defending but he scored three goals also.

"We've had a lot of different injuries so it's not just one reason but that's why it's important to have a squad."

Meanwhile, Eliaquim Mangala is unlikely to return to action until after next month's international break.
